区块链游戏怎么做:从设计到开发的全面指南

    时间:2025-07-10 15:00:55

    主页 > 数字圈 >

      引言

      随着区块链技术的不断发展,区块链游戏逐渐成为游戏行业的新宠。区块链游戏不仅可以提供更安全的游戏环境,还能让玩家在游戏中享受真正的资产拥有权,这一点对于传统游戏行业来说是一个巨大的突破。本篇文章将围绕“区块链游戏怎么做”这一主题,从设计理念到开发实践,提供详尽的指导。

      1. 理解区块链游戏的基本概念

      在开始设计和开发区块链游戏之前,我们首先需要理解区块链的基本概念。区块链是一种去中心化的分布式账本技术,每一笔交易都会在区块链上记录,并且是不可篡改的。对于游戏来说,区块链可以用来记录游戏内物品的所有权、交易记录以及游戏资产的生成和流通。

      区块链游戏通常可以分为几种类型,包括基于NFT(非同质化代币)的游戏、去中心化游戏以及具有通证经济模型的游戏。每种类型都有其独特的玩法和机制,对应的开发方式也有所不同。

      2. 设计区块链游戏的核心玩法

      在设计区块链游戏时,最重要的一点是核心玩法。一个好的游戏玩法不仅要吸引玩家,还需要与区块链的特点相结合。许多区块链游戏都利用了NFT技术,让玩家拥有游戏内资产的真实所有权。例如,在一款NFT卡牌游戏中,玩家可以购买、出售和交易自己的卡牌,而这些卡牌的所有权都是通过区块链进行验证的。

      设计核心玩法时,可以考虑以下几个方面:

      3. 选择合适的区块链平台

      在设计好游戏的玩法后,接下来的步骤是选择合适的区块链平台。目前常见的区块链平台包括以太坊、Binance Smart Chain、Polygon等。每个平台都有其优缺点:

      选择合适的区块链平台后,还需要考虑如何与游戏中的资产进行交互,以及如何确保玩家的交易安全与便捷。

      4. 开发区块链游戏的技术要点

      区块链游戏的开发涉及多个技术要点,其中包括智能合约的编写、前端与后端的开发、以及去中心化的存储解决方案等。开发者需要掌握相关的编程语言,如Solidity(用于以太坊智能合约的编程语言),同时还需了解如何使用Web3.js等库与区块链进行交互。

      5. 测试与上线区块链游戏

      在游戏开发完成后,充分的测试是必不可少的。需要进行功能测试、安全性测试、以及用户体验测试,确保游戏在上线后能够顺利运行。尤其是区块链游戏,由于涉及到玩家资产,安全性测试显得尤为重要。

      上线后,持续的运营和更新也是成功的关键。通过玩家反馈不断游戏体验,同时推出新的玩法和活动,保持玩家的活跃度和参与度。

      6. 维护游戏的经济平衡

      区块链游戏往往包含复杂的经济系统,因此在开发过程中需要特别关注经济平衡。这包括游戏内货币的发行、通货膨胀和通缩等因素的影响。开发者需要实时监控经济数据,调整相应的机制,以保证游戏的可持续性。

      可能相关的问题

      如何设计NFT在区块链游戏中的应用?

      NFT(非同质化代币)在区块链游戏中有着广泛的应用,主要体现在游戏资产的独特性和稀缺性。设计NFT时,首先需要明确哪些游戏元素将被转化为NFT,比如角色、装备、土地等。每种NFT的属性和稀有度都需要在设计阶段加以考虑。

      接下来,开发者需要确保每个NFT的唯一性,可以根据UUID(通用唯一识别码)或ERC721、ERC1155等标准来生成NFT。玩家在游戏中获取的NFT可以通过交易所进行买卖,也可以在游戏内进行拍卖,这样不仅能增加玩家的参与感,还能提升游戏的经济价值。

      在设计过程中,还需考虑NFT的可使用性。例如,某些NFT可能只在特定的事件或活动中才能释放其潜力,这种机制可以增加游戏的社交属性。

      除此之外,NFT还可以通过“铸造”机制让玩家自己创建和定制个性化的游戏资产。这样的设计不仅增加了游戏的互动性,也能提升玩家的忠诚度。

      区块链游戏如何保证玩家资产的安全?

      保证玩家资产的安全是区块链游戏开发的重点之一。区块链的去中心化特性使其比传统中央服务器更安全,但也并非万无一失。开发者可以通过以下几种方式来保护玩家资产的安全:

      最后,一旦发生资产损失事故,游戏团队需要建立清晰的应对流程,确保及时修复问题并给予玩家必要的补偿。

      区块链游戏的市场前景如何?

      区块链游戏的市场前景被视为相对广阔的。随着NFT和去中心化金融(DeFi)概念的普及,越来越多的玩家愿意尝试区块链游戏。此外,区块链游戏更高的透明度和资产确权能力,使它们在传统游戏玩家和加密社区中都获得了极大的关注。

      但是,要注意的是,区块链游戏市场也面临着激烈的竞争。成千上万的项目涌现,让玩家难以选择。为了在这场竞争中脱颖而出,开发团队需要有创新的玩法、高质量的游戏内容以及强大的运营能力。此外,营销策略的有效性也是关键,包括与社交媒体大V合作、社区建设等。

      如果能够有效结合游戏的趣味性与区块链的经济模型,未来区块链游戏有潜力成为游戏行业的重要组成部分。

      区块链游戏如何进行社区构建?

      社区是区块链游戏成功的基石,玩家不仅是游戏的参与者,更是生态圈的贡献者。一款游戏如果能建立强大的社区,将会为其后续的更新与推广提供丰厚的土壤。在构建社区时,可以考虑以下几种策略:

      此外,建立良好的沟通渠道也是社区运营的关键,包括Discord、Telegram等社交平台的利用,让玩家能及时获得游戏的动态以及参与互动。

      在开发区块链游戏时遇到的挑战有哪些?

      虽然区块链游戏有着广阔的前景,但在开发过程中也面临许多挑战:

      综合而言,成功的区块链游戏不仅需要技术的创新,还需要注重玩家体验以及市场的多元化。随着技术和市场的不断成熟,区块链游戏必将在未来展现更大的潜力。

      以上是围绕“区块链游戏怎么做”这一主题的详细介绍,从基本的概念到具体的开发流程,再到可能遇到的问题,每个方面我们都进行了深入探讨。通过这一指南,相信你能对区块链游戏的设计与开发有一个全面的了解。